5.1 Establish Clear Communication
Before engaging in any corehard activities, ensure that both partners feel comfortable discussing their boundaries, fears, and desires. Open communication will lay the groundwork for a successful experience.
5.2 Consent is Non-Negotiable
Consent should never be assumed, and it must be ongoing. Make sure that both partners have a clear understanding and can feel confident in their ability to withdraw consent at any time during encounters.
5.3 Create Safe Words and Signals
Developing a safe word or signal can help ensure that both partners feel secure. These words or gestures must be simple and agreed upon prior to engaging in any activity.
5.4 Engage in “Aftercare”
Aftercare is an essential part of many corehard experiences, providing emotional support and physical care after intense encounters. Discussing feelings post-interaction can enhance the bond between partners.
5.5 Set Boundaries
Establish limits regarding what is acceptable within corehard practices, and respect these boundaries at all times. This will create a safe environment for both partners and contribute to a mutual sense of security.
